Emma Stone On Inequality In Hollywood: Expresses Her Discontent Over Pay?

American Actress, Emma Stone opened up about the disparity in the wages of men and women in the Hollywood. Expressing her disappointment on the issue, Emma Stone experssed her sentiment that everyone deserves fair treatment and payment.

In an exclusive interview with Vogue magazine, the Oscar nominee who turns 28 this November revealed that though she disagrees with pay inequities of the industry, she has not personally been impacted by it. "I've been lucky enough to have equal pay to my male costars. Not 'lucky.' I've had equal pay to my male costars in the past few films," Stone added.

"But the industry ebbs and flows in a way that's like, 'How much are you bringing into the box office?' 'How much are you the draw is the other person the draw?' " Emma said expressing her discontent. She added that the system is insane and there is no excuse to continue it anymore.

Also, the actress stated that she felt uncomfortable talking about it to her agent or lawyer as it involves looking at oneself from the outside. The actress's statements buttress the claims by another popular actress, Jennifer Lawrence who strongly criticized the pay disparity between male and female actors, earlier last year, reported CNN.

Emma Stone is all set for the opening of her movie "La La Land" that is slated for release in December, this year. Starring alongside Ryan Gosling, Stone portrays an aspiring actress trying to make her way in a cruel town. Ryan Gosling plays a jazz-club owner and the story revolves around their romance while they encounter the struggles in their respective careers.

The film has already received several accolades when it opened at the Venice Film Festival. Appreciating the film, actor Tom Hanks was quoted saying " If the audience doesn't go and embrace something as wonderful as this, then we are all doomed."
